Starting a new job can be daunting! There are so many new tools and processes to absorb, not to mention all the industry lingo! At OpenTable, we recognize how significant it is for employees to not only learn the procedural aspects of a job but to also appreciate the scope and impact of the role before they can really help our customers. That’s why we’re looking for a seasoned trainer to help new and existing employees master the skills they need to drive outstanding customer experiences.
As an Account Manager Trainer for Restaurant Sales & Services at OpenTable, your primary responsibility will be in delivering comprehensive training programs to AM and AMCQ roles passionate about sales skills, sales process, customer experience, customer support techniques, and standard processes to positively influence Account Management critical metrics. You will play a pivotal role in crafting the success of team members by equipping them with the knowledge and skills vital to excel in their roles. Ideal candidates possess a deep understanding of sales techniques, customer service standard methodologies, and onboarding processes and can inspire and empower employees to achieve outstanding results.
In this role, you will :
- Play a key role in the design of high impact training programs tailored to the specific needs of customer-facing employees.
- Deliver scalable enablement programs that positively impact employee productivity and achieve desired business outcomes.
- Conduct engaging training experiences, applying innovative adult-learning techniques and tools to engage learners and enhance knowledge / skill retention.
- Confidently and effectively facilitate and present programs while keeping audiences engaged and delivering a clear and memorable message.
- Consult effectively with key collaborators to develop precise learning outcomes ahead of training design and execution
- Maintain current knowledge of the latest industry trends, tools and insights, incorporating them into training programs.
- Adapt training techniques to accommodate diverse learning styles, skill levels, and cultural backgrounds within the audience; Ability to seamlessly adjust execution between in-person vs. virtual learner cohorts.
- Complete workload with strong program management skills, including leading milestones, meeting deliverables, prioritization, knowing who to keep informed, why and how often, and knowing when to escalate.
- Drive continuous improvement through the implementation of meticulous assessments to evaluate the effectiveness of training programs, including gathering feedback from participants and collaborators to identify areas of future improvement
- Supervise the performance of learners pre and post-training to measure the direct impact of training programs on individual and team success
- Maintain an up-to-date understanding of all products and services that OpenTable offers.
